There are lots of remarkable appearing benchmarks and technological terms which hint that I ought to additionally miss out on the efficiency of the 2018 iPad Pro. It's powered by a new A12X Bionic chip that uses 8 cores separated in 4 efficiency cores and 4 power performance cores (up from the 6 cores of the A12 chip in the apple iphone XS).

According to Apple, this makes it quicker than 92% of all portable PC computers sold in the past year. The chip additionally consists of a brand-new GPU with 7 cores, the M12 Motion co-processor and a Neural Engine with 8 cores for approximately 5 trillion operations per second.
